          Abstract

          Proprotein convertase subtilisin/kexin type 9 (PCSK9) is a regulator of LDL-cholesterol receptor homeostasis and emerges as a therapeutic target in the prevention of cardiovascular (CV) disease. This prospective cohort study analyzes risk prediction with PCSK9 serum concentrations in patients with stable coronary artery disease (CAD) on statin treatment.
